Nestled in the heart of Konya, the Shams of Tabriz Mosque and Tomb is a remarkable tribute to the legendary figure Shams Tabrizi, a close companion of the famous poet Rumi. The mosque, with its stunning architecture and serene ambiance, invites visitors to immerse themselves in the spiritual legacy of Sufism. As you approach the mosque, you'll be greeted by elegant minarets and beautifully crafted mosaics that reflect the rich cultural heritage of the region. The interior is adorned with intricate calligraphy and colorful stained glass that create a mesmerizing atmosphere, perfect for contemplation and reflection. Beyond its architectural beauty, the Shams of Tabriz Mosque and Tomb holds a deep spiritual significance for many. It serves not only as a place of worship but also as a pilgrimage site for those seeking to connect with the teachings of Shams Tabrizi. Visitors can explore the tranquil gardens surrounding the mosque, providing a peaceful retreat from the bustling city. The site is particularly enchanting during the early morning or late afternoon when the soft light casts a magical glow on the surroundings, enhancing the spiritual experience. Whether you are a history enthusiast, an art lover, or a spiritual seeker, the Shams of Tabriz Mosque and Tomb offers a unique glimpse into the mystical world of Sufism. Local tips

  • Visit early in the morning to enjoy a quieter atmosphere and witness the beautiful sunrise.
  • Dress modestly as this is a place of worship and respect for the local customs is important.
  • Take a guided tour to learn more about the history and significance of Shams Tabrizi and the mosque.
  • Explore the surrounding gardens for a peaceful escape and great photo opportunities.
  • Check the visiting hours to avoid crowds, especially on weekends and holidays.

Getting There

  • Walking

    If you are in the city center of Konya, start at the Alaeddin Hill (Alaeddin Tepesi). From Alaeddin Hill, head southeast on Alaeddin Boulevard (Alaeddin Bulvarı) towards Şems Street (Şems Cd.). Continue walking straight for about 1.5 km. You will pass by several local shops and cafes. Keep an eye out for signs pointing to Şems of Tabriz Mosque and Tomb. When you reach the intersection with Şems Street, turn left. The mosque and tomb will be on your right after a short walk.

  • Public Transport (Bus)

    From Mevlana Museum (Mevlana Müzesi), take the bus numbered 4 or 5 from the nearby bus stop. Make sure to check the bus schedule, as it runs frequently. Ride for about 10 minutes and get off at the 'Şems Cd.' stop. After getting off, walk a short distance (about 5 minutes) down Şems Street, and you will see the Shams of Tabriz Mosque and Tomb on your left.

  • Taxi

    If you prefer a more direct route, you can take a taxi from any location in Konya. Simply tell the driver to take you to 'Şems of Tabriz Mosque and Tomb' or give them the address: Şemsitebrizi, Şems Cd., 42030 Karatay/Konya. The ride from the city center should take about 10-15 minutes, depending on traffic.
